  • Patent number: 10158078
    Abstract: The present invention relates to a composition for an insulator of a thin film transistor, an insulator and an organic thin film transistor comprising the same. The insulator of a thin film transistor prepared with the composition of the present invention displays an excellent permittivity along with a low surface energy, and the organic thin film transistor comprising the same displays an improved organic semiconductor morphology formed on the top surface of the insulator, so that it can bring the effect of reducing leakage current density, improving charge carrier mobility, and improving current on/off ratio.

  • Publication number: 20180325405
    Abstract: The present disclosure relates to measuring biosignals (particularly, electroencephalogram) of fish in a non-invasive and multi-channels manner, with a multi-channel electrode array of one or more conductive plates non-invasively attached to the epidermis of the fish outside of the water a; a reference electrode non-invasively attached to the epidermis of the fish outside of the surface of the water; a supply device that supplies a predetermined material and oxygen to the fish outside of the water; and a minute tube inserted into the oral cavity of the fish outside of the water to resuscitate the fish in a stable state to generate normal electroencephalogram.

  • Publication number: 20180273678
    Abstract: The present invention provides a selective bonding method of polymer substrates. The present invention allows selective interfacial bonding between a polymer substrate and a parylene layer by using a mask pattern and plasma treatment, and enables the formation of a three-dimensional structure by injecting a fluid into a non-bonded area.

  • Publication number: 20180256102
    Abstract: An exemplary neural electrode device as disclosed includes a storage in which fluid is stored; an electrode array which delivers the fluid to a subject, acquires bio-signals from the subject, or provides stimulus to the subject; an electronic circuit unit which allows the fluid to flow from the storage to the electrode array, processes the bio-signals acquired from the electrode array, or provides stimulus signals to the electrode array; and a connection portion which includes a cable extending from the storage to the electrode array and provided with a leading wire electrically connecting the electrode array to the electronic circuit unit, and a fluidic channel through which fluid flows between the storage and the electrode array.

  • Publication number: 20160178604
    Abstract: The present disclosure relates to a microelectrode for measuring EMG signals of a laboratory microfauna. The present disclosure includes a metal plate with an insulating plate deposited on a surface, a plurality of silicon substrates disposed on the insulating plate, the silicon substrates being electrically connected to the metal plate, covered with an insulator, and adjacent to one another, and a plurality of needle electrodes, each formed on the respective silicon substrates as an integral part thereof, wherein the needle electrodes have the same predetermined length, have a tapered shape from the respective silicon substrates, are spaced apart from each other by a predetermined distance, and wherein a metallic layer is formed on each of the needle electrodes by depositing metal materials, the insulator is formed on the metallic layer, and a portion of the metallic layer at a tip is exposed.

  • Publication number: 20160175606
    Abstract: Disclosed herein is an optical stimulator inserted into a biological tissue for obtaining a neural signal by stimulating a neuron with a propagating light. The optical stimulator includes: a main unit comprising electrodes, and electrical terminals connected to the electrodes; a waveguide extended from a side of the main unit and comprising electrochromic films; and a light source disposed in the main unit and producing light along a direction in which the electrochromic films formed in the waveguide are arranged. Each of the electrical terminals is connected to the respective electrochromic films, and the electrochromic films change a propagation path of light reaching the electrochromic films upon a voltage being applied thereto from the electrical terminals, to stimulate a neuron.

  • Patent number: 8055194
    Abstract: A method for searching for devices for Bluetooth communication in a wireless terminal, by which Bluetooth communication can be easily carried out through various search options. The method includes displaying search options if a search is selected for a Bluetooth communication, displaying search keywords corresponding to a search option if the corresponding search option is selected from the search options, and attempting a Bluetooth communication with a device corresponding to the corresponding search keyword if the corresponding search keyword is selected from the displayed search keywords.

  • Publication number: 20100292478
    Abstract: A process of preparing a radioactive compound containing a fluorine-18 isotope is provided. In one embodiment, the process may comprise forming a [18F] fluoroalkyl triflate by triflating a [18F] fluoroalkyl compound with AgOTf, and forming a [18F] fluoroalkylated radioactive compound through alkylation between the [18F] fluoroalkyl triflate and a radioactive compound precursor having at least one group selected from NH, OH and SH.

  • Publication number: 20090243856
    Abstract: Disclosed herein is a system for managing chemicals using Radio-Frequency Identification (RFID). A storage facility identification tag, attached to a chemical storage facility in a laboratory, stores the unique identification code of the chemical storage facility and a list of chemicals. A chemical identification tag, attached to the cover of a chemical container, stores the unique identification code of the chemical storage facility and chemical-related information. A mobile terminal, provided with an RFID reader, receives and outputs the unique identification code of the chemical storage facility, the list of the chemicals, and the chemical-related information.
